Transaction 109663847656660510e80876284d8efd21cbbe5824d3d2579e6bf73c691d5481
1 Input
1 Output
-
109663847656660510e80876284d8efd21cbbe5824d3d2579e6bf73c691d5481:0
- value
- 148902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9c803282fea2020988154140d47d927d72c471d OP_EQUAL
- address
- 3P18yLiN2czCefVtFTDJqekbcYLHQD8FjY